It is more than a cookbook. Kanaan – Cooking without borders is a manifesto for understanding, compassion, and what good food has always been able to do: bring people together. Every day at the Kanaan restaurant in Berlin, Israeli Oz Ben David and Palestinian Jalil Dabit demonstrate that cuisine speaks a universal language – and that where there is cooking, understanding begins.

Together with friends and companions from a wide variety of backgrounds, they invite guests into their kitchen for dialogue. The result is recipes that extend far beyond the borders of the Levant—aromatic dishes full of warmth, soul, and symbolic power.
“For us, it's not just about preparing good food and being wholehearted hosts,” say Oz and Jalil. “We want to keep writing new stories – with every good moment we experience together.”
In their book, they cook with Berlin's governing mayor Kai Wegner, women's rights activist Seyran Ateş, pastor Maike Schöfer, Muslim theologian Kübra Dalkilic, and Jewish education officer Rebecca Rogowski, among others. Their conversations and dishes represent what resonates in Canaan: hope, respect, and belief in shared values.
Photographer Elissavet Patrikiou translates these culinary encounters into impressive images. With a keen sense of authenticity and atmosphere, she captures those moments when food becomes emotion—honest, sensual, and deeply human.
